Peter Bergen is a British-American print and broadcast journalist, author, and CNN's national security analyst. In 1997, Bergen produced the first television interview with Osama Bin Laden. The interview, which aired on CNN, marked the first time that bin Laden declared war against the United States to a Western audience.  Bergen has written four books: Holy War, Inc.: Inside the Secret World of Osama bin Laden (2001), The Osama bin Laden I Know (2006), The Longest War: The Enduring Conflict Between America and al-Qaeda (2011) and Man Hunt: The Ten Year Search for Bin Laden From 9/11 to Abott…
